The background of Star Trek Day

“Star Trek” was conceived as a television series about the universe. The premiere episode broadcast on September 8, 1966, the date of the holiday. Later installments were considerably more successful, despite the fact that this first season’s ratings steadily declined. After some time, the programme was cancelled. In 1969, however, reruns of the programme helped establish a cult following.

The first “Star Trek” convention was surprisingly attended by tens of thousands of enthusiasts in 1972. This demonstrated the show’s popularity and the originality of its premise, which ultimately led Paramount to revive the series. The Emmy-winning “Star Trek” animated series was produced by Paramount, as was The Motion Picture, which performed reasonably well at the box office.

The second film in the Star Trek series, “Star Trek II: The Wrath of Khan,” would become the franchise’s first significant hit. Star Trek ultimately produced six films, all of which are now regarded as classics. In 1987, Paramount reintroduced the Star Trek universe to television with “Star Trek: The Next Generation.”
In the twenty-first century, “Star Trek” is by far Paramount’s most successful franchise, and additional installments of the original work will continue to be released. Multiple “Star Trek”-themed television programmes, animated series, and films are still in production. This cultural importance is what makes “Star Trek” worthy of an annual celebration.
